Esta operação é uma operação diária básica para internautas, mas para proteger os direitos autorais (como romances e fotos), alguns sites proíbem os usuários de executar essas operações, para que os usuários possam impedir que o texto seja navegado pela copia e colando.
Evento Oncypy:
Definição e uso
O evento de oncopy é disparado quando o usuário copia o conteúdo do elemento.
Dica: o evento Oncypy também será acionado quando o usuário copia um elemento, por exemplo, copiando o elemento <MG>.
Dica: o evento oncopy é geralmente usado no elemento <input> do tipo = "text".
Dica: Existem três maneiras de copiar elementos e conteúdo:
Pressione Ctrl + C
Selecione "Copiar" no menu Editar em seu navegador
Botão de correio do mouse, selecione o comando "copiar" no menu de contexto.
Suporte do navegador
gramática
Em html:
<elemento oncopy = "myscript">
Em JavaScript:
object.oncopy = function () {// opera myscript}Em JavaScript, use o método addEventListener ():
object.addeventListener ('cópia', myscript); // ie8 e versões anteriores do IE não suportam o método addEventListener ()Evento OnPaste:
Definição e uso
O evento OnPaste é disparado quando o usuário passa o texto no elemento.
Nota: Embora os elementos HTML utilizados suportem o evento OnPaste, nem todos os elementos são realmente suportados, como o elemento <p>, a menos que o conteúdo seja definido como "True" (veja mais exemplos abaixo).
Dica: o evento OnPaste é geralmente usado para o elemento <input> do tipo = "text".
Dica: Existem três maneiras de colar o conteúdo nos elementos:
• Pressione Ctrl + V
• Selecione "Colar" no menu Editar do navegador
• Clique com o botão direito do mouse no botão do mouse e selecione o comando "Colar" no menu de contexto.
Suporte do navegador
gramáticaEm html:
<Element onPaste = "MyScript">
Em JavaScript:
object.onPaste = function () {// opera o MyScript; }Javascript Total, use o método addEventListener ():
object.addeventListener ('pasta', myscript); // Internet Explorer 8 e anterior não suporta o método addEventListener ().Princípio de implementação:
Realize um evento de cópia e cola e retorne false no evento.
Código JavaScript:
var BodyMain = document.getElementById ('BodyMain'); // copiando o bodymain.oncopy = function () {return false; } // colar o bodymain.onPaste = function () {return false;}O código de implementação acima para proibir a cópia e a colagem do JavaScript é todo o conteúdo que compartilhei com você. Espero que possa lhe dar uma referência e espero que você possa apoiar mais o wulin.com.